Hi,

I want to apply a multiselect query to an Entity with a OneToMany Relation. The Entity looks like this:

Code:
@Entity
@Table(name = "TRAVEL_ENTITY")
public class TravelEntity {

    // instance data

    private UUID uuid;   
    private String description = "";
    private Set<MatterOfExpenseEntity> mattersOfExpense = new HashSet<MatterOfExpenseEntity>();
   
    @Type(type = "com.hrs.svl.travel.commons.type.usertypes.UUIDUserType")
    @Id
    @Column(name = "UUID", length = 36)
    public UUID getUuid() {
        return this.uuid;
    }

    public void setUuid(UUID uuid) {
        this.uuid = uuid;
    }   

    @Column(name = "DESCRIPTION", length = 100)
    public String getDescription() {
        return this.description;
    }

    public void setDescription(String description) {
        this.description = description;
    }


    @OneToMany(mappedBy = "travel", cascade = CascadeType.ALL)
    public Set<MatterOfExpenseEntity> getMattersOfExpense() {
        return this.mattersOfExpense;
    }

    public void setMattersOfExpense(Set<MatterOfExpenseEntity> mattersOfExpense) {
        this.mattersOfExpense = mattersOfExpense;
    }

}

@Entity
@Table(name = "MATTER_OF_EXPENSE_ENTITY")
@Inheritance(strategy = InheritanceType.JOINED)
@DiscriminatorColumn(name = "TID", discriminatorType = DiscriminatorType.STRING)
public class MatterOfExpenseEntity {
    // instance data

    private UUID uuid;
    private TravelEntity travel;

    // public

    @Type(type = "com.hrs.svl.travel.commons.type.usertypes.UUIDUserType")
    @Id
    @Column(name = "UUID", length = 36)
    @Attribute(primaryKey = true, index = 1)
    public UUID getUuid() {
        return this.uuid;
    }

    public void setUuid(UUID uuid) {
        this.uuid = uuid;
    }

    @ManyToOne(cascade = {CascadeType.PERSIST, CascadeType.MERGE}, optional = false, targetEntity = TravelEntity.class)
    @JoinColumn(name = "OR_TRAVEL")
    @Relation(target = TravelEntity.class, inverse = TravelEntity.MATTERS_OF_EXPENSE, index = 3)
    public TravelEntity getTravel() {
        return this.travel;
    }

    public void setTravel(TravelEntity travel) {
        this.travel = travel;
    }
}


The query looks like this:

Code:
                CriteriaBuilder cb = jpa.getCriteriaBuilder();
                CriteriaQuery<Object[]> cq = cb.createQuery(Object[].class);
                Root from = cq.from(TravelEntity.class);

                cq.multiselect(from.get("mattersOfExpense").alias("MATTER"), from.get("uuid").alias("ID"));

                Predicate pr = cb.equal(cb.literal(UUID.fromString("3f1302f7-1f2f-11e1-94ec-78acc0b04e2e")), from.get("uuid"));

                cq.from(TravelEntity.class);
                cq.where(pr);

                Object o3 = jpa.createQuery(cq).getResultList();


This query results in a following SQL-Query which starts with the following select-clause:

Code:
select . as col_0_0_,


This is obversely not valid SQL-Code (the dot after the select is nonsense) and the execution of the query results in the following exception:

Code:
Caused by: com.mysql.jdbc.exceptions.jdbc4.MySQLSyntaxErrorException: You have an error in your SQL syntax; check the manual that corresponds to your MySQL server version for the right syntax to use near 'as col_0_0_


The problem seems to be the OneToMany relation because if I change this to OneToOne relation everything is fine.

What is wrong with my query?
Is there an alternative way to generate the query?
